Table IVa.
30-day Outcomes for EVAR
| Asymptomatic, %(n) | P-value Asymptomatic vs. Symptomatic | Symptomatic,%(n) | Symptomatic vs. Ruptured | Ruptured, %(n) | ||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| N | 3665 | 312 | 289 | |||||
| 30-day Mortality | 1.4 | (50) | .001 | 3.8 | (12) | <.001 | 22 | (62) |
| Major Adverse Event | 3.7 | (136) | <.001 | 9.3 | (29) | <.001 | 31 | (89) |
| Return to Operating Room | 3.7 | (136) | .49 | 4.5 | (14) | <.001 | 13 | (38) |
| Bleeding | 9.9 | (364) | <.001 | 18 | (57) | <.001 | 65 | (189) |
| Cardiac Arrest with CPR | 0.4 | (14) | <.001 | 1.9 | (6) | <.001 | 8.7 | (25) |
| Myocardial Infarction | 1.2 | (45) | .02 | 2.9 | (9) | .05 | 6.2 | (18) |
| Prolonged Ventilation (> 48hours) | 0.7 | (27) | <.001 | 2.9 | (9) | <.001 | 18 | (53) |
| Acute Kidney Injury | 0.3 | (12) | .11 | 1.0 | (3) | .08 | 3.1 | (9) |
| New Dialysis | 0.5 | (18) | 1.0 | 0.3 | (1) | <.001 | 10 | (29) |
| Post-op UTI | 1.1 | (39) | .77 | 0.6 | (2) | .12 | 2.1 | (6) |
| Surgical Site Infection | 1.7 | (61) | 1.0 | 1.6 | (5) | .02 | 4.8 | (14) |
| Pulmonary Embolism | 0.2 | (7) | .48 | 0.3 | (1) | .36 | 1.0 | (3) |
| DVT | 0.4 | (16) | .65 | 0.6 | (2) | .02 | 3.5 | (10) |
| Lower Extremity Ischemia | 1.2 | (44) | 1.0 | 1.0 | (3) | .08 | 3.1 | (9) |
| Rupture of Aneurysm after repair | 0.1 | (4) | 1.0 | 0.0 | (0) | <.001 | 4.8 | (14) |
| Ischemic Colitis | 0.5 | (17) | .20 | 1.0 | (3) | <.001 | 8.3 | (24) |
| Length of Stay (days, median (IQR))a | 2 | (1–3) | <.001 | 3 | (2–6) | <.001 | 7 | (4–11) |
| Readmissiona | 7.7 | (276) | .03 | 11 | (34) | .49 | 9.4 | (22) |
Bleeding defined as transfusion of 1 or more units of red blood cells from surgical start up to and including 72 hours post-op; Acute kidney injury defined as increase in Creatinine > 2mg/dl from pre-op; Surgical site infection includes superficial, deep, and organ space infection; Ischemic colitis identified by presence of diagnosis on discharge summary or endoscopy for the purpose of diagnosis; UTI=Urinary tract infection (excluded patients with UTI pre-op); DVT=deep venous thrombosis
Excluded patients who died in-hospital; Also data gathered from combination of historical readmission variable and more current one
